Book cover of The Unconscious

The Unconscious

A Conceptual Analysis

by Alasdair Chalmers MacIntyre
Language: English
Release Date: February 24, 2004

This edition includes a substantial new preface by the author, in which he discusses repression, determinism, transference, and practical rationality, and offers a comparison of Aristotle and Lacan on the concept of desire. MacIntyre takes the opportunity to reflect both on the reviews and criticisms of the first edition and also on his own philosophical stance.
